Microsoft .NET — это универсальная платформа для разработки и выполнения приложений, поддерживающая кроссплатформенную разработку на языках C#, F# и Visual Basic. Платформа включает в себя среду выполнения и инструменты, необходимые для запуска современных программ на различных операционных системах, включая Windows, Linux, MacOS и мобильные платформы. Благодаря открытому исходному коду и совместимости с .NET Standard, она подходит как для локальных проектов, так и для масштабных решений в облаке.
Описание Microsoft .NET
Microsoft .NET представляет собой современную, модульную платформу, предназначенную для создания приложений различной сложности — от настольных программ до облачных сервисов и мобильных решений. Архитектура .NET позволяет разработчикам использовать единый код для различных платформ, что ускоряет процесс разработки и упрощает сопровождение программного обеспечения. Среда поддерживает языки программирования C, F# и Visual Basic, интегрируется с популярными редакторами, такими как Visual Studio и Visual Studio Code, и предоставляет доступ к мощным инструментам командной строки.
- Поддержка кроссплатформенной разработки для Windows, Linux и MacOS.
- Встроенная совместимость с .NET Framework и библиотеками Mono.
- Наличие SDK с инструментами CLI для автоматизации сборки и тестирования.
- Высокая производительность и оптимизация для работы в облаке.
- Регулярные обновления и поддержка сообществом с открытым исходным кодом.
Платформа .NET обеспечивает надёжную основу для создания масштабируемых и безопасных приложений с длительным сроком эксплуатации.
Как пользоваться Microsoft .NET
Для начала работы с Microsoft .NET необходимо установить пакет SDK, который включает компиляторы, средства отладки и среду выполнения. После установки разработчик может создавать проекты с помощью командной строки или интегрированной среды, например, Visual Studio. Проекты можно компилировать, запускать и тестировать локально, а затем разворачивать на серверах или публиковать в digital store для распространения. Работа с API, подключение библиотек и настройка конфигураций осуществляется через стандартные инструменты платформы.
Достоинства и недостатки
Microsoft .NET предлагает широкие возможности для разработчиков, но, как и любая технология, имеет свои особенности. Платформа активно развивается, поддерживает современные подходы к разработке, такие как микросервисы и контейнеризация, и обеспечивает высокую производительность. В то же время, для полного использования всех функций может потребоваться время на изучение архитектуры и инструментов. Тем не менее, преимущества значительно перевешивают возможные сложности на начальном этапе.
Плюсы:
- Открытый исходный код и бесплатное использование в коммерческих проектах.
- Поддержка множества языков программирования и редакторов, включая Sublime Text и Vim.
- Гибкая система зависимостей и совместимость с существующими .NET-библиотеками.
Минусы:
- Требует определённых знаний для эффективного использования инструментов CLI и SDK.
Скачать
Microsoft .NET доступен для установки на официальном сайте разработчика. Процесс загрузки прост и не требует сложных настроек — достаточно выбрать подходящую версию для вашей операционной системы. После установки можно сразу приступать к созданию проектов или запуску готовых приложений, включая решения, интегрированные с office-приложениями или использующие компоненты visual c. Поддержка window-сессий и многопоточности делает платформу удобной для разработки в различных сценариях.
| Разработчик: | Microsoft Corporation |
| Лицензия: | Бесплатно |
| Язык: | Русский |
| Платформа: | Windows 7, 8.1, 10, 11 x86-x64 (32/64 Bit) |



![Программный интерфейс Microsoft .NET 7.0.19 Runtime [Ru En]](https://freeprogram.top/wp-content/uploads/programmnyi_interfeis_microsoft_net_7_0_19_runtime_ru_en.webp)

![Установка Microsoft .NET 7.0.19 Runtime [Ru En]](https://freeprogram.top/wp-content/uploads/ustanovka_microsoft_net_7_0_19_runtime_ru_en.webp)